COMMERCE BUSINESS DAILY ISSUE OF OCTOBER 13,1995 PSA#1451

Navy Public Works Center, Washington Navy Yard, Bldg. 175, Code 221, Washington DC 20374

Z -- UPGRADE POWER DISTRIBUTION, BUILDING 1, U.S. NAVAL OBSERVATORY, WASHINGTON, DC SOL N68925-94-B-A200 DUE 121295 POC Linda Ford, Contract Specialist, FAX (202)685-8236. Pre-Solicitation: The work includes disconnection and removal of exterior underground vault main service entrance bank, disconnection and removal of all existing service entrance equipment including panelboard current transformer (CT) cabinet, metering, etc., disconnect and remove all existing panelboards as indicated on the contract documents, installation of one (1) outdor padmounted 500 KVA transformer rated 13.2Y/4.16KV - 208Y/120V, 3 phase, 60 cycle, installation of a new ampere, 120/208V, 3 phase, 4 wire main distribution panelboard along with emergency kirk-key interlocked tie switch and required metering and other work as described in the specifications. The Estimated Cost Range is $500,000 and $1,000,000. The Standard Industrial Code is 1731. The related Small Business Size Standard is $7 million. The proposed contract listed here is being considered 100% set-aside for Small Disadvantaged Business (SDB) Concerns. Interested SDB Concerns should provide in writing to the Contracting Officer as early as possible, but not later than 15 days after receipt of this notice, specifically: 1) a list of references past and present government/ commercial contracts, similar to the work described in this notice, which includes the contract number, title of contract, dollar value, name of person to contact, and telephone number, 2) a positive statement of self certification as a SDB Concern, and 3) a statement of capability to obtain the required bonds. If adequate interest is not received from SDB Concerns, the solicitation with be issued on an unrestricted basis and another notice will be issued. Therefore, replies to this office are requested from all interested business as well as SDB Concerns. The Bid Opening Date is on or about 12 Decmber 1995. Submit requests by fax for receiving plans and specifications when they become available on or about 9 November 1995 to (202)685-8288, Attn: Bob Roth or they may be picked up in person from Building 166, West Side, 1st Floor, Washington Navy Yard. There is no charge for plans and specs. Only one set per firm. Please fax all bid inquiries in writing to (202)685-8236 Telephone inquiries/requests will not be honored. (0284)
